        /// <summary>
        /// Shuts down all of the managed nodes permanently.
        /// </summary>
        /// <param name="nodeReuse">Whether to reuse the node</param>
        /// <param name="terminateNode">Delegate used to tell the node provider that a context has terminated</param>
        protected void ShutdownAllNodes(bool nodeReuse, NodeContextTerminateDelegate terminateNode)
        {
            // INodePacketFactory
            INodePacketFactory factory = new NodePacketFactory();

            List <Process> nodeProcesses = GetPossibleRunningNodes().nodeProcesses;

            // Find proper MSBuildTaskHost executable name
            string msbuildtaskhostExeName = NodeProviderOutOfProcTaskHost.TaskHostNameForClr2TaskHost;

            // Search for all instances of msbuildtaskhost process and add them to the process list
            nodeProcesses.AddRange(new List <Process>(Process.GetProcessesByName(Path.GetFileNameWithoutExtension(msbuildtaskhostExeName))));

            // For all processes in the list, send signal to terminate if able to connect
            foreach (Process nodeProcess in nodeProcesses)
            {
                // A 2013 comment suggested some nodes take this long to respond, so a smaller timeout would miss nodes.
                int timeout = 30;

                // Attempt to connect to the process with the handshake without low priority.
                Stream nodeStream = NamedPipeUtil.TryConnectToProcess(nodeProcess.Id, timeout, NodeProviderOutOfProc.GetHandshake(nodeReuse, enableLowPriority: false, specialNode: false));

                // If we couldn't connect attempt to connect to the process with the handshake including low priority.
                nodeStream ??= NamedPipeUtil.TryConnectToProcess(nodeProcess.Id, timeout, NodeProviderOutOfProc.GetHandshake(nodeReuse, enableLowPriority: true, specialNode: false));

                // Attempt to connect to the non-worker process
                // Attempt to connect to the process with the handshake without low priority.
                nodeStream ??= NamedPipeUtil.TryConnectToProcess(nodeProcess.Id, timeout, NodeProviderOutOfProc.GetHandshake(nodeReuse, enableLowPriority: false, specialNode: true));
                // If we couldn't connect attempt to connect to the process with the handshake including low priority.
                nodeStream ??= NamedPipeUtil.TryConnectToProcess(nodeProcess.Id, timeout, NodeProviderOutOfProc.GetHandshake(nodeReuse, enableLowPriority: true, specialNode: true));

                if (nodeStream != null)
                {
                    // If we're able to connect to such a process, send a packet requesting its termination
                    CommunicationsUtilities.Trace("Shutting down node with pid = {0}", nodeProcess.Id);
                    NodeContext nodeContext = new NodeContext(0, nodeProcess.Id, nodeStream, factory, terminateNode);
                    nodeContext.SendData(new NodeBuildComplete(false /* no node reuse */));
                    nodeStream.Dispose();
                }
            }
        }

        /// <summary>
        /// Instantiates a new MSBuild process acting as a child node.
        /// </summary>
        public bool CreateNode(int nodeId, INodePacketFactory factory, NodeConfiguration configuration)
        {
            ErrorUtilities.VerifyThrowArgumentNull(factory, "factory");

            if (_nodeContexts.Count == ComponentHost.BuildParameters.MaxNodeCount)
            {
                ErrorUtilities.ThrowInternalError("All allowable nodes already created ({0}).", _nodeContexts.Count);
                return(false);
            }

            // Start the new process.  We pass in a node mode with a node number of 1, to indicate that we
            // want to start up just a standard MSBuild out-of-proc node.
            // Note: We need to always pass /nodeReuse to ensure the value for /nodeReuse from msbuild.rsp
            // (next to msbuild.exe) is ignored.
            string commandLineArgs = $"/nologo /nodemode:1 /nodeReuse:{ComponentHost.BuildParameters.EnableNodeReuse.ToString().ToLower()} /low:{ComponentHost.BuildParameters.LowPriority.ToString().ToLower()}";

            // Make it here.
            CommunicationsUtilities.Trace("Starting to acquire a new or existing node to establish node ID {0}...", nodeId);

            long        hostHandShake = NodeProviderOutOfProc.GetHostHandshake(ComponentHost.BuildParameters.EnableNodeReuse, ComponentHost.BuildParameters.LowPriority);
            NodeContext context       = GetNode(null, commandLineArgs, nodeId, factory, hostHandShake, NodeProviderOutOfProc.GetClientHandshake(ComponentHost.BuildParameters.EnableNodeReuse, ComponentHost.BuildParameters.LowPriority), NodeContextTerminated);

            if (null != context)
            {
                _nodeContexts[nodeId] = context;

                // Start the asynchronous read.
                context.BeginAsyncPacketRead();

                // Configure the node.
                context.SendData(configuration);

                return(true);
            }

            throw new BuildAbortedException(ResourceUtilities.FormatResourceStringStripCodeAndKeyword("CouldNotConnectToMSBuildExe", ComponentHost.BuildParameters.NodeExeLocation));
        }
